Krótka charakterystyka kwalifikacji
Graduates apply advanced knowledge in medical and health sciences and in individualised medical care as nurses. They design and plan human resources policies to match patients’ needs. They organize and manage nursing care, cooperate with members of medical teams to enhance the quality of care services, monitor and introduce tools to monitor the quality of nursing care and they use a wide array of methods in organising and managing care. They identify and solve efficiency issues to improve effectiveness in nursing positions. They autonomously dispense medicines, specialist nutrients and other medical substances, along with writing prescriptions or orders. They solve professional issues relating to complex decision making in critical cases – typical of medical workplaces. They act in full compliance with applicable law in their professional performance. They select appropriate teaching methodologies as well as learning and teaching evaluation frameworks. They design programmes in health education and implement them in response to the identified community needs. They are prepared to conduct research and disseminate research results in their field of research.<br><br>Graduates are qualified for performing at all nursing positions in health care and other related institutions. Also, graduates are qualified to run their own business in the field of qualification, cooperate with institutions active in the field of public health, conduct research at universities or research centres, work with health insurance institutions, work with State Sanitary Inspectorate and other organisations active in the field of environmental protection, work with institutions educating for the nursing profession, offering advanced training in nursing or performing in public health education. <br><br>Graduates are prepared to manage relevant human resources, organize the work of nursing teams and supervise the quality of care delivered. Specialist knowledge of medical subjects, psychology and psychotherapy based on the Christian axiological foundation enables graduates to autonomously assess each case and situation and undertake adequate measures. Graduates demonstrate trained habits of lifelong education and professional development.<br><br>

Qualifications to perform in the nursing profession.<br>Earning a professional qualification title: Master of Science in Nursing, pursuant to par. 37(1) of the Act of 15 July 2011 on the Nursing and Obstetrician Profession (cons. text: JL 2016/1251)<br>Dodatkowe informacje na temat kwalifikacji
The qualifications and the title of Master of Science in Nursing allow enrolment to studies at EQF level 8 and to post-graduate courses.<br>Informacje dodatkowe
